Economic policy uncertainty and international corporate leasing
Abstract We examine the effect of economic policy uncertainty (EPU) on the corporate lease decision using an international sample of 19 countries. The use of operating leases increases when EPU is heightened. The documented leasing increase is more pronounced for financially constrained firms, firms facing greater operating volatility, or those that ...

Do robots boost productivity? A quantitative meta‐study
ABSTRACT This meta‐study analyzes the productivity effects of industrial robots. More than 1800 estimates from 85 primary studies are collected. The meta‐analytic evidence suggests that robotization has so far provided, at best, a small boost to productivity. There is strong evidence of publication bias in the positive direction.
